		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The planet Mars, like Earth, has clouds in its atmosphere and a deposit of ice at its north pole. But unlike Earth, Mars has no liquid water on its surface. The rustlike color of Mars comes from the large amount of iron in the planet&#8217;s soil. Image credit: NASA/JPL/Malin Space Science Systems.</p>
